Deck Reinforcement Service in Seattle, WA

Deck reinforcement services help homeowners ensure their outdoor structures remain safe, stable, and durable over time. These services typically involve strengthening existing decks by adding support beams, replacing aging joists, or installing additional bracing to handle increased weight or wear. Projects can range from upgrading a small backyard deck to reinforce it against seasonal weather effects, to larger installations that support multi-level or heavily used outdoor spaces. Property owners often seek these services when noticing signs of sagging, creaking, or deterioration, or when planning to add heavier furniture or features like hot tubs.

Before requesting deck reinforcement,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of work needed to improve stability and safety. It’s helpful to assess the current condition of the deck, including the age of the materials, any visible damage, and the load capacity required for future use. Clarifying whether the project involves partial repairs or comprehensive reinforcement can guide the process. Property owners should also consider any local building codes or permits that might apply, especially for larger or more complex projects, to ensure the work meets safety standards and long-term durability expectations.

Project Types

Common Deck Reinforcement Service Jobs

Deck reinforcement - strengthens existing deck structures to improve safety and stability.

Post and beam upgrades - enhances support for decks with aging or weakened posts and beams.

Joist reinforcement - adds support to prevent sagging and improve load capacity.

Ledger board stabilization - secures and stabilizes the connection between the deck and the house.

Framing repairs - addresses damaged or rotted framing components for long-term durability.

Support column installation - adds or replaces columns to distribute weight evenly and prevent shifting.

FAQ

Deck Reinforcement Service Questions

What is deck reinforcement? Deck reinforcement involves adding structural support to strengthen the existing deck and improve safety and durability.

When should a deck be reinforced? Reinforcement is recommended when a deck shows signs of sagging, cracking, or has experienced increased load demands.

What materials are used for deck reinforcement? Common materials include steel brackets, additional joists, and ledger board supports to enhance stability.

Can reinforcement extend the life of a deck? Yes, properly reinforced decks can have an extended lifespan and better withstand weather and usage stresses.
